Study of formation constant of schiff base containing Thiazole ring in mixed solvent media and their thermodynamic parameters

International Journal of Chemical Studies · 2020 · Vol. 8(2) · pp. 31–34
BN Muthal

Abstract

The Schiff bases derived from substituted aminothiazole i.e.2-4-Diamino-5-phenylthiazole and R-Substituted salicyladehyde (R-5-CH3, and 5-Cl) or 2hydroxy-1-naphthaldehyde i.e. (5MS)2 DPT, (5CS)2 DPT and (HN) 2 DPT and Rare earth metal ion LaIII, CelIl, PrlIl, NdlIl, SmlIl
